Sleep bruxism (SB) involves grinding or clenching of the teeth and jaw during sleep and is considered a sleep-movement-related disorder. Many dentists believe that SB is a pathogenic factor in myofascial temporomandibular disorder (TMD); with the majority of data relying on patients self-reports and indirect observation. from the Minoan civilization focuses with practicality and function. Later‚ as the styles mature‚ the pieces become more refined and sophisticated. There are three phases of Minoan pottery. Early‚ 3650-2160 BCE‚ Middle‚ 2160-1600 BCE‚ and Late‚ 1600-1070 BCE. Each phase correspond with cultural shifts within the civilization. Some phases build on previously styles. WHAT IS SICK BUILDING SYNDROME (SBS)? Throughout human civilization‚ humans have been determined to create indoor environments which get us out of the natural elements and protect us from sickness and other hazards. We have created buildings which do just this by creating building envelopes which mechanically‚ or less commonly naturally‚ take in outdoor air.
